This Hazardous Weather Outlook is for portions of the Missouri
Ozarks and extreme southeast Kansas.

.DAY ONE...Today and Tonight.

Weather hazards expected...

  Limited lightning risk.

DISCUSSION...

Showers are moving across portions of south-central Missouri this
morning and will spread west through the day Monday, dissipating
by evening. There is a low chances, 30 percent or less, for a few
embedded rumbles of thunder within this activity, especially
further east.

.DAYS TWO THROUGH SEVEN...Tuesday through Sunday.

No hazardous weather is expected at this time.

.SPOTTER INFORMATION STATEMENT...

  Spotter activation will not be needed through tonight.
